Come learn about Nova Scotia’s natural heritage, our forests!  Enjoy tasty burgers and salads and enjoy a local brew with friends.

Matt Miller, forester and Forestry Coordinator at the Ecology Action Centre, will explore the uniqueness of Nova Scotia’s Acadian forest ecosystem, discuss some of the threats facing our forests and the people and wildlife that rely on them, and highlight some of the exciting, innovative forest sustainability initiatives happening across the province.  

Matt will be joined by Billy McDonald, long-time nature educator and founder of Redtail Nature Awareness and Tom Miller (Matt’s father), president of the Friends of Redtail Society, 40-year veteran of the Nova Scotia forest sector and early advocate for ecologically-based forestry.

Billy and Tom will share stories of their time in the backwoods of Nova Scotia and the story of the Friends of Redtail Society’s efforts to reclaim, re-vision and restore our relationship with the forest.

By the end of the evening you will have a new appreciation for our forests, a stronger connection to nature and a greater understanding of how you can play a positive role in shaping the forest around you. 

Funds raised will support the Friends of Redtail Society - friendsofredtail.ca/
